Software as a Service (SaaS) is an increasingly popular method of delivering software and services to customers. It boasts a variety of advantages, and is being adopted by companies of all sizes. Although many people are aware of the concept of SaaS, they may not be aware that Gmail is one of its most popular applications.
In a nutshell, SaaS is a form of cloud computing which allows customers to gain access to and use web-based applications and services. This eliminates the need to buy and install software on a local machine, and instead permits customers to access and use the software through the internet.
Gmail is a prime example of this type of cloud computing, offering customers a range of advantages such as instant access to emails, the ability to collaborate with others, share and store files, and access emails from any device with an internet connection. It also provides additional features and tools like labels, filters, and search functions which make it easier to manage emails.
The main benefits of Gmail are its accessibility and scalability. Because it is cloud-based, it can be accessed anywhere with an internet connection. This allows companies to stay in contact with their customers and collaborate with their team regardless of their location. Furthermore, businesses can easily adjust their usage of Gmail as needed by adding or removing users, or upgrading or downgrading their account without any installation or configuration.
In addition, Gmail is cost-effective. Since it is billed on a subscription basis, businesses don’t need to make a major initial investment in software or hardware. This makes it easier to manage their budget and use resources efficiently.
Finally, Gmail is secure and dependable. It provides advanced security features like two-factor authentication and encryption to protect user accounts and data. It is also supported by Google’s powerful infrastructure, ensuring that it is always available and up and running.
In conclusion, Gmail is a perfect example of SaaS. It offers businesses benefits such as accessibility, scalability, cost-effectiveness, and security. It also provides various features and tools to help manage emails. With all these advantages, it’s no wonder that Gmail is one of the most widely used examples of SaaS.
